Year 8 Solar Car Challenge in Bunbury

Year 8 students from the College competed in the Solar Car Challenge in Bunbury on Tuesday, placing third overall after a number of heats.

Xavier Mockford, Julius Bain, Gabe Doolan and Thomas Toohey designed and built their solar car over the last three weeks in preparation for the first regional leg since the national competition began two years ago. The boys spent lunchtimes and weekends testing and perfecting their design, solving problems and making small adjustments along the way.

Their hard work paid off, as the MacKillop team performed extremely well for most of the afternoon. Their solar car easily won each heat, before a couple of unlucky track snags in the semi-final hampered them against cars they had previously beaten.

The boys were awarded $30 from sponsor Synergy, and thoroughly enjoyed the experience. Head of Science, Mr Defrancesco, said it was great to see so much enthusiasm from the students, who kept finding ways to improve their car’s performance. “We look forward to another go at it next year.”
